SEM is looking for an experienced Cloud Engineer. In this role, you'll design, develop, and maintain the cloud infrastructure for a Geographic Information System (GIS) application. This application will use hybrid cloud architecture, integrating both Azure cloud services and on-premises physical servers. The application’s data pipelines will intake various GIS data types and use AI tools to deliver advanced geospatial solutions. The successful applicant will work to ensure the infrastructure is secure, efficient and scalable alongside a well-rounded team of developers.

Responsibilities
  • Design and implement infrastructure solutions for the GIS application
  • Develop and maintain robust cloud-based services and tools
  • Integrate diverse data types and AI tools into the Azure cloud infrastructure
  • Ensure the security, scalability and reliability of the environment
  • Collaborate effectively with a cross-functional team to achieve project objectives
  • Monitor and optimize performance, along with associated costs
  • Troubleshoot and resolve issues across the hybrid environment
Requirements
  • Proven experience as a Cloud Engineer or in a similar professional role, ideally with hybrid cloud environments
  • A minimum of a Bachelor’s degree or equivalent in Computer Science, Information Technology, or a related field
  • Strong knowledge of Azure cloud platform
  • Experience with ArcGIS Enterprise / Online and GIS applications
  • Proficiency in integrating AI tools and handling diverse data types
  • Solid understanding of cloud security, scalability, and reliability
  • Excellent problem-solving skills and attention to detail
  • Excellent communication skills and ability to work collaboratively in a team environment
